Document Summary

Historically, both ocd and ptsd belonged to anxiety disorders, sharing core feature (anxious distress) At the heart of it there is a similarity of the disorder, inability to control one"s thoughts that results in distress. Force us to ask quesions about how we separate one disorder from another. Classiicaion is important because how they"re grouped together implies a shared symptom/treatment/ same root cause o. Ptsd and ocd oten result from traumaic events of episodes. People might say they have a shared eiology, a trauma where they now have problems with stress. First "shell shock" then "combat faigue" ater wwii. Soldiers heart: diagnosis given out to soldiers that experienced terrible things while at war, needed special ime. New chapter on trauma and stress-related disorders in dsm 5. War experience, sexual abuse, vicims of crime or industrial accidents likely candidates. Dsm doesn"t menion cause, no agreement on it, however we menion cause in ptsd.
